This summer, Ballet East is proud to offer our Advanced Variations Summer Intensive, a focused training experience designed for dancers ready to move beyond learning steps and into mastering performance.
Unlike traditional summer intensives that emphasize volume and pace, this program prioritizes individual coaching, technical refinement, and artistic development through classical and contemporary variations.
Dancers will receive:
Focused coaching in classical & contemporary solo work
Advanced technical refinement and musicality training
Artistry, character, and stage presence development
Video review sessions and a professional photo session for portfolios
Audition and competition preparation in a supportive, high-level environment
This intensive is ideal for dancers preparing for competitions, auditions, or the upcoming performance season who benefit from personalized feedback and intentional growth.

This summer, Ballet East invites dancers to join our Choreography and Repertory Summer Intensive, a dynamic, performance-driven program centered on working as a collective ensemble.
Designed for dancers who thrive in group settings, this intensive focuses on learning and performing classical and contemporary repertory quickly and effectively—just as dancers are expected to do in professional rehearsal environments.
Dancers will experience:
Learning multiple ballets and repertory works throughout the intensive
Training in ensemble awareness, spacing, timing, and musical unity
Being challenged to learn choreography quickly and efficiently
Partnering fundamentals and supported partnering work (level appropriate)
Artistic coaching that encourages individuality while strengthening group cohesion
Emphasis on adaptability, professionalism, and rehearsal efficiency
Weekly in-studio performances to build confidence and stage experience
To support performance readiness, the program also includes:
Daily stretching and flexibility training
Strengthening, conditioning, and cross-training for injury prevention
Rehearsal endurance and stamina development
This intensive is ideal for dancers who want to:
Improve performance confidence on stage
Strengthen corps and ensemble skills
Experience what it’s like to rehearse and perform as part of a cohesive group
Prepare for more advanced performance and ensemble opportunities
Continue developing technique while growing as both a dancer and an artist
The Choreography and Repertory Intensive offers a true studio-to-stage experience, helping dancers grow not only as individuals but as essential members of an ensemble.

We are pleased to introduce the Ballet East Youth Ensemble Summer Intensive, the culminating program of our Summer 2026 Training Pathway and the official selection and creation period for our award-winning Ballet East Youth Ensemble.
Required for all dancers interested in Ballet East Youth Ensemble or Youth Ensemble 2 for the 2026/2027 season.
This immersive intensive is designed for dancers who are ready to experience what it truly means to train, rehearse, and perform as part of a professional-caliber ensemble. All ensemble works for the upcoming season will be created during this intensive, and all ensemble members and soloists for the 2026–2027 season will be selected exclusively from this program.
This intensive is designed to:
Assess dancers for Youth Ensemble and Youth Ensemble 2 placement
Create all ensemble works for the 2026/2027 performance and competition season
Select ensemble members and soloists for the upcoming year
Establish expectations, work ethic, and artistic standards for the season ahead
Elevate dancers through advanced training that prepares them for competitions, auditions, and future opportunities.
Participation is required for any dancer wishing to be considered for Youth Ensemble placement.
What dancers will experience:
A rehearsal process that mirrors professional company expectations
All group choreography will be staged during the intensive
Emphasis on precision, musical unity, and collective responsibility
Daily technique and conditioning classes
Rehearsal stamina and mental endurance development
Increased expectations for correction retention and adaptability
Training as a committed team, not as individuals
Accountability to the group and shared artistic responsibility
Understanding ensemble roles, featured casting, and performance dynamics
Building trust, awareness, and cohesion on and off stage
Faculty will assess dancers on:
Technical consistency and growth
Performance quality and stage presence
Musicality and ensemble awareness
Work ethic, focus, professionalism, and coachability
Ability to contribute positively to a team-driven environment
Selections will be made for:
Ballet East Youth Ensemble
Youth Ensemble 2
Soloist opportunities for the 2026–2027 season
This intensive provides dancers with a clear, transparent pathway into Ballet East’s performance ensembles while preparing them for the expectations of a demanding and rewarding season ahead.

At its core, the program at Ballet East is a carefully curated 10+ year journey designed to facilitate the complete realization of powerful cognitive, technical, artistic, emotional, and social skills that form the foundation for your child’s future. We place an enormous amount of importance on the continuation of your child’s education and the consistency of their training. Due to the structure of the curriculum, it is not permitted for families taking part in summer studies to “pause” their child’s progress and tuition to rejoin mid-session due to vacation or travel. The curriculum is based on sequential learning; therefore, if your child decides to drop in mid-session, they will be asked to continue during the following session.
Curriculum for Summer Programs
The curriculum for the Repertoire Intensive will include Ballet Technique, Pointe, Pre-Pointe, Pas de Deux, Contemporary, Choreography Workshops, Plyometrics, Progressing Ballet Technique, Strength and Stretch, Repertoire, Composition, and more!

During the summer female students are required to wear a black leotard and pink tights or skin tone tights that match the color of the student's ballet/pointe shoes. For males, please wear a white fitted t-shirt, black full length ballet tights with black shoes or white shoes and socks.
All jewelry should be removed prior to entering the classroom for safety reasons. Stud earrings or small dangle earrings are permitted.
